In almost all the windows applications that handle the text, like in Microsoft word, you can make use of the ASCII code for inserting the blank character or the non-breaking space. This can be done by pressing the Alt and then typing 255 from the numeric keypad, and finally releasing the ALT key. And please keep in mind that this will not work if you will be using the ordinary number key.
